Serves as a key member of the Athletics executive leadership team. Provides strategic financial leadership and ensures the division's financial sustainability. Responsibilities
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:
Develops and oversees long-term financial plans aligned with Athletic Department goals Leads budgeting, forecasting and financial reporting whilst advising on strategic decisions and resource allocation Manages daily financial operations of the Athletics division, including payroll, procurement, and travel Oversees preparation of mandated financial reports to include annual EADA, NCAAA and USG reports Supports revenue generation through strategic direction and planning areas such as partnerships, fundraising and media rights Oversees capital project financing, facility planning, debt service monitoring and capital budgets Oversees all athletics contracts (service, game, and others) to ensure fulfillment, payouts, and compliance Works closely with University leadership, legal and finance to ensure alignment Represents Athletics in institutional planning and external financial reporting Evaluates current business models and leads efforts to modify or redesign business models as necessary Innovates the use of technology and increase the overall level of business intelligence throughout the organization Effectively communicates with conference peers, conference office, NCAA office, and CFP and/or bowl or other group to properly manage associated budget related details Builds, leads, and motivates a high-performing team Supervises assigned staff, including performance management Serve as a Program administrator for assigned sport(s) Required Qualifications
